Behind The Lens

Location

On an early morning walk round Marine Bay in Weston-super-Mare. I turned back and looked towards the buildings behind the bay and saw some beautiful morning colours rising behind the buildings. I just had to snatch this one!

Time

It was about 6am in the morning, just as the sun was starting to rise.

Lighting

As this was early morning, I wanted to find a morning sunrise scene but was caught unexpectedly with the brilliance of red colouring from the rising sun. Just subtle enough with the soft morning low light, to capture a great reflection.

Equipment

I only used my beginner’s Nikon D3300 DSLR and 18-55mm kit lens. A free hand shot.

Inspiration

I love colour and reflections and I was inspired by the redness of the rising sun contrasting with the soft lilac tones across the water.

Editing

Yes I pulled some detail from the shadows on the buildings as I exposed for the sunlight, and cropped the image to improve the balance.

In my camera bag

In my bag I have my Nikon D3300, kit lens, extra 200mm zoom lens, a few density filters and a small tripod, for when there is a need for sharpness. Although I prefer free hand to feel a little more creative.

Feedback

It’s simple. Reflections need water and light. Find a spot that’s the right side of both!
